Conveniences and Applications of Laser Therapy
Laser treatment uses a variety of benefits and applications that improve individual care across various clinical areas. You'll locate it effective for discomfort administration, minimizing inflammation, and promoting wound healing.
In dermatology, it aids deal with acne marks, coloring issues, and wrinkles, offering people smoother skin. In dental care, laser therapy reduces discomfort throughout treatments and accelerate recovery.
You can additionally utilize it in physical therapy to relieve chronic discomfort and boost flexibility. Furthermore, laser therapy has applications in ophthalmology, such as correcting vision problems with accuracy.
With its non-invasive nature, laser treatment reduces the danger of issues and shortens healing times, making it a beneficial device for both specialists and people seeking reliable treatment options.
